参数
进程间通信实验
进程间通信调试以下程序给出运行结果并分析其程序原理:(1)编写两个程实现进程的无名管道和有名管道通信。要求分别调用pipe()、close()、write()、read()、popen()、pclose()、mknod()、mkfifo()、open()实现多个进程间的通信。#include<stdio.h>#include <stdlib.h>#include <u...
二维数组和二维指针作为函数的参数
二维数组和二维指针作为函数的参数在C语言中,二维数组和二维指针都可以用作函数的参数。虽然二者都可以传递多维数组,但它们在内存中的存储方式和指针的访问方式略有不同。在这篇文章中,我们将探讨这两种传递多维数组的方式。首先,让我们定义一个简单的二维数组和一个指向二维数组的指针,以便更好地说明它们的区别:```cint array[3][3] = { {1, 2, 3}, {4, 5, 6}, {7, 8...
如何给通过uniapp生成的h5通过url传递参数
网页app如何给通过uniapp⽣成的h5通过url传递参数需求描述:外链的 h5 是通过 uniapp ⽣成,然后将此 h5 内嵌在 uni-app 的 webview 中,通过在该 h5 链接拼接上参数传递给 h5在 h5 中提取 url 参数的办法:onLoad() {let name = QueryString('name')}methods: {getQueryStrin...
支付宝接入教程以及服务端给app写支付接口入门
关于支付宝接入的几点说明和解释在实际的开发中,我们看到开放平台密钥和合作伙伴密钥的时候,有没有直接就懵逼了的赶脚?反正我是的有。因为不是每个人都经常去开发支付功能,更不会有事儿没事儿去调这些个密钥,毕竟跟钱相关的东西,谁都会冷静三分!鉴于此,我简略说两点。1.官方答复说,合作伙伴密钥适用于合作伙伴密钥常被适用于API 1.0版本的支付和移动支付(手机网页支付),而开放平台密钥是作为APP支付设定的...
uniapp实现被浏览器唤起
uniapp实现被浏览器唤起1,配置UrlSchemes在manifest.json配置/* 应⽤发布信息 */"distribute" : {/* android打包配置 */"android" : {"schemes" : [ "CCC" ],...},/* ios打包配置 */"ios" : {"urltypes" : [{"urlidentifier" : "com.BBB.AAA","u...
Uniapp实现与外部HTML页面通信
Uniapp实现与外部HTML页⾯通信 Uniapp 实现与外部 HTML 页⾯通信在 uniapp 中 经常会 内嵌 html, 并且 有时候会还有 ...
带参数调用子程序怎么实现
带参数调用子程序怎么实现在大多数编程语言中,带参数调用子程序的实现可以分为以下几个步骤:1.定义子程序签名:在主程序或其他子程序中,首先要定义需要调用的子程序的签名。子程序的签名包括子程序名和参数列表,参数列表指定了子程序接受的参数类型和顺序。2.传递参数:在调用子程序时,需要将参数值传递给子程序接受参数的位置。传递参数的方式可以是按值传递,按引用传递或按地址传递,具体取决于编程语言的特性。3.调...
c语言调用子程序
在C语言中,子程序(也称为函数)是通过函数调用来实现的。函数调用是执行子程序的一种方式,它会将控制权转移给子程序,子程序执行完毕后,控制权会返回到原来的地方,并返回一个结果。要调用一个子程序,你需要在代码中包含该子程序的声明或定义,并在需要执行该子程序的地方使用函数名和括号内的参数列表来调用它。下面是一个简单的示例,演示了如何在C语言中调用一个子程序:#include <stdio.h>...
c语言子程序返回多个参数,C语言中实现参数个数不确定的函数
c语⾔⼦程序返回多个参数,C语⾔中实现参数个数不确定的函数C语⾔中有⼀种长度不确定的参数,形如:"…",它主要⽤在参数个数不确定的函数中,我们最容易想到的例⼦是printf函数。(注意:在C++中有函数重载(overload)可以⽤来区别不同函数参数的调⽤,但它还是不能表⽰任意数量的函数参数。)C语⾔⽤va_start等宏来处理这些可变参数。这些宏看起来很复杂,其实原理挺简单,就是根据参数⼊栈的特...
python多进程调用模块内函数_python子进程模块subprocess详解与应用...
python多进程调⽤模块内函数_python⼦进程模块subprocess详解与应⽤实例之⼀分类: Python/Ruby2014-09-09 10:59:42subprocess--⼦进程管理器⼀、subprocess 模块简介subprocess最早是在2.4版本中引⼊的。subprocess模块⽤来⽣成⼦进程,并可以通过管道连接它们的输⼊/输出/错误,以及获得它们的返回值。它⽤来代替多个旧...
子程序中参数
子程序中参数一、局部量、全程量与作用域我们知道,程序有变量说明语句,过程与函数也有变量说明语句。凡在程序中使用到的量,均必须先说明后使用,这是Pascal语言所具有的一个特点。同样,在过程与函数内部使用的变量,也应该在本过程或函数中加以说明,这种在子程序内部说明的变量,称之为局部变量。另外,将那些在程序开头的说明部分加以定义与说明的量,称为全程量。在不同的说明语句部分所说明变量,在程序中对此变量进...
子程序的参数传递
⼦程序⼀般都是完成某种特定功能的程序段。当⼀个程序调⽤⼀个⼦程序时,通常都向⼦程序传递若⼲个数据让它来处理;当⼦程序处理完后,⼀般也向调⽤它的程序传递处理结果,我们称这种在调⽤程序和⼦程序之间的信息传递为参数传递。 ⽤程序向⼦程序传递的参数称为⼦程序的⼊⼝参数,⼦程序向调⽤它的程序传递的参数称为⼦程序的出⼝参数。⼦程序的⼊⼝参数和出⼝参数都是任意项,对某个具体的⼦程序来说,要根据具体...
c语言项目 定义和调用函数
在C语言中,函数是代码的子程序,它可以执行特定的任务并返回一个值。函数可以被其他函数或主程序调用。要定义一个函数,可以使用以下语法:creturn_type function_name(parameter_list) { // 函数体}其中: `return_type`是函数的返回值类型,可以是`void`(表示函数不返回任何值)或其他数据类型。 `function_name`是函数的...
VC++函数使用方法
函 数函数也称子程序、例程或过程,它是把一些相关的语句组织在一起,用于解决某一特定问题的语句块。函数分为系统函数和自定义函数两种。系统函数是C++标准函数库中提供的可以在任何程序中使用的公共函数,使用系统函数必须指定函数所在的包含文件,如sqrt()函数的使用要包含math.h头文件,自定义函数库是用户为了满足自己的需求自己定义的函数。 下面主要介绍自定义函数:1.函数的定义:函数必须...
易语言置入代码
易语言置入代码速度及完成一些易不好直接完成的操作,是追求置入代码的全部!如果你不同意,那基本上不用往下看。汇编功底只有靠自己,这里只是讲述在易语言中如何使用“置入代码()”来嵌入汇编及其注意要点。这是自己的学习体会,如有理解错误或bug请指出,谢!我们先来了解一下置入代码是怎么的一回事汇编中nop(10010000)是空操作指令,我们先使用8个空操作来给程序作个“置入代码”的标记。于是,在一个新建...
matlab主函数调用子函数
matlab主函数调用子函数在 MATLAB 中,我们可以将一些功能单一的代码块抽象成一个子函数,方便代码的维护和管理。而主函数可以通过调用子函数的方式来实现更加复杂的逻辑。下面我们来讲一下 MATLAB 主函数调用子函数的方法以及注意事项。1. 子函数的编写在 MATLAB 中,我们可以创建一个 .m 文件来编写子函数。一个子函数应该只实现一个功能,并要求输入和输出参数明确的格式。例如,我们创建...
ExcelVBA之传递参数给一子程序以及如何将值从子程序传递回给主调过程...
ExcelVBA之传递参数给⼀⼦程序以及如何将值从⼦程序传递回给主调过程当你⼤VBA程序得越来越⼤,要很好地维护这么多的代码⾏是很困难的。要让你的程序容易编写、理解和改变,你就应该使⽤井井有条的结构化程序。你只要简单地将⼤问题分成⼀些可以同时执⾏的⼩问题就⾏。在VBA中,你可以通过创建⼀个主过程和⼀个或多个⼦过程来实现它。因为主过程和⼦过程都是⼦程序下⾯的例⼦显⽰过程AboutUser。该过程要求...
西门子S7-200系列PLC带参数子程序的编写方法
西门子S7-200系列PLC带参数子程序的编写方法摘要:西门子S7-200系列PLC是一种应用广泛的控制器,在实际应用中,我们常常需要编写带参数子程序来完成复杂的控制任务。本文将详细介绍在S7-200 PLC中编写带参数子程序的方法,包括参数的定义、传递和使用等方面,旨在帮助PLC编程工程师更好地理解和掌握这一技术。关键词:S7-200 PLC;带参数子程序;参数定义;参数传递;参数使用。正文:一...
宏与子程序的区别
宏与子程序的区别 宏和子程序都是为了简化源程序的编写,提高程序的可维护性,但是它们二者之间存在着以下本质的区别: 1 、在源程序中,通过书写宏名来引用宏,而子程序是通过调用子程序的例子 CALL 指令来调用; 2 、汇编程序对宏通过宏扩展来加入其定义体,宏引用多少次,就相应扩展多少次,所以,引用宏不会缩短目标程序;而子程序代码在目标程序中只出现一次,调用子程序...
fortran中procedure声明的用法
fortran中procedure声明的用法在Fortran中,procedure声明用于定义过程变量和过程指针。过程可以是函数或子程序(subroutine)。通过使用procedure声明,可以在其他过程中传递过程作为参数,或者在运行时动态选择要执行的过程。过程声明的一般语法如下:```fortranprocedure([, attribute-list] :: procedure-name)...
实验四 子程序实验(一)
实验四 子程序实验(一)本实验的目的在于让读者掌握同一模块内的子程序调用的方法。1.实验目的(1)掌握主程序与子程序之间的调用关系及其调用方法。(2)掌握子程序调用过程中近程调用与过程调用的区别。(3)掌握通过堆栈传送参数的方法。2.实验内容(1)将BUP开始的10个单元中的二进制数转换成两位进制数的ASCII码,并在屏幕上显示出来。要求码型转换通过子程序HEXASC实现,在转换过程中...
子程序的设计方法
子程序的设计方法子程序又称为过程,相当于高级语言中的过程和函数。在一个程序的不同部分,往往要用到“类似”的程序段,即这些程序段的功能和结构形式都相同,只是某些变量赋值不同。此时就可以把这些程序段写成子程序形式,以便需要时调用它。一、过程定义伪操作 过程名 PROC Attribute …… 过程名 ENDP 其中,过程名是子程序入口的符号地址,与标号...
欧姆龙cp1h常用指令学习(六)功能块、子程序
欧姆龙cp1h常用指令学习(六)功能块、子程序欧姆龙PLC的功能块勇哥暂时理解为是一种拥有输入输出参数的自定义的指令。它的好处是实现功能复用,从梯形图上看来很简洁,可以减少plc内存消耗。 如果仅仅是实现功能的利用,显然功能块无法和子程序区分开来,功能块拥有自己特殊的定义与调用方式。功能块有两种方法,一是梯形图形式,二是ST文本形式(结构文本),两者区别只是编码方式不同。(一) 梯形图形式的功能块...
实训七、子程序调用指令基本知识
课题实训七、子程序调用指令基本知识 6课时教学要求知识目标能力目标情感目标教材分析重点难点教具 与设备教法教授法、演示法、实验法板书设计教学内容复习:循环指令在的具体显现。跳转指令有哪些?顺控继电器(SCR)指令可以应用在哪些现象中?新课教学:子程序是将程序进行分块。主程序中使用的指令决定...
主程序与子程序之间的参数传递的四种方法
主程序与⼦程序之间的参数传递的四种⽅法主程序调⽤⼦程序是,往往需要向⼦程序传递⼀些参数,同样,⼦程序运⾏的时候也需要把⼀些结果参数传回给主程序,主程序与⼦程序之间的这种信息传递称为参数传递,我们把主程序传给⼦存续的参数称为⼦程序的⼊⼝参数,把由⼦程序传给主程序的参数称为⼦程序的出⼝参数有多种传递参数的⽅法,寄存器传递法,约定内存单元传递法,堆栈传递法和CALL后续传递法4.2.1利⽤寄存器传递参数...
Excel VBA编程技巧之函数与子程序
Excel VBA编程技巧之函数与子程序Excel是一款功能强大的电子表格软件,而VBA(Visual Basic for Applications)是一种可以在Excel中进行编程的语言。函数和子程序是VBA编程中非常常用的两个概念,它们能够帮助我们处理复杂的数据和实现自动化的操作。在本文中,我们将讨论函数和子程序的基本用法以及一些常见的编程技巧。函数是一种接受输入参数并返回结果的代码块。在Ex...
汇编语言子程序设计
汇编语言子程序设计汇编语言子程序设计简介汇编语言是一种低级语言,经常被用来编写底层的软件和嵌入式系统。在汇编程序中,子程序是一种可重复使用的代码块,用于执行特定的任务。本文将介绍汇编语言中子程序的设计和实现方法。我们将以x86架构为例,使用NASM作为汇编器。子程序的定义与调用子程序是一个独立的代码块,可以接受输入参数并返回结果。在汇编语言中,子程序的定义通常由标签来表示,调用子程序时可以使用CA...
shell脚本返回值及其使用场景的实现
shell脚本返回值及其使⽤场景的实现应⽤场景在⼀些应⽤中(⽐如Jenkins),嵌⼊了shell脚本,系统通过shell脚本的返回值来判断执⾏结果,如果返回值⾮0,则发⽣了执⾏错误,需要中⽌执⾏,这在使⽤单个命令时没有问题。然⽽,在shell (A)脚本⼜调⽤了shell脚本⽂件(B )时,当被调⽤的shell脚本B执⾏过程中发⽣了错误时,系统不会认为B有问题,⽽是继续往下执⾏。这样就会掩盖了问...
Shell脚本之变量与传递参数1
Shell脚本之变量与传递参数1何为Shell脚本第⼀个shell脚本#!/bin/bashecho "hello world"shell是指⼀种应⽤程序,这个应⽤程序提供了⼀个界⾯,⽤户可以通过这个界⾯访问操作系统内核服务。Ken Thompson的sh是第⼀种UnixShell,Windows Explorer 是⼀个典型界⾯shell。Shell脚本(shell script),⼀种专门为s...
shell-函数之参数使用详解
shell-函数之参数使⽤详解参数的调⽤⽅法在其他语⾔中,函数参数分为形参和实参,其中,形参是函数定义时就指定的参数;⽽实参是函数被调⽤时才指定的参数(通常放在括号⾥,参数之间⽤逗号隔开)shell的函数参数⽐较特殊,实际上shell将脚本的参数和函数的参数统⼀处理,怎么调⽤脚本参数就怎么调⽤函数参数。function_name arg arg1 arg2 ...function_name是函数名...